Is Evolution True? looks at some of our most basic questions about Life. Was Life Created or did it simply evolve, by chance, as Darwin suggested? How scientific was Darwin’s theory, really? Is it still scientific today? Has Darwinian evolution ever-truly-been proven to be true? Or is it now little more than a creation myth for the modern atheistic belief system? This fascinating book takes a brief, but powerful look at many of the questions surrounding this controversial topic: the cosmic fine tuning, the origins of cellular life, the origins of Life’s mysterious DNA CODES, spiritualism vs materialism, Darwin’s atheistic theory of Natural Selection and Common Descent, the evolution of Cells, Shells, Whales, Fish, Spiders, Birds, Bats, Butterflies and Humans by mere chance vs. an intelligently driven unfoldment of Life on Earth. It provides us with an easy to follow discussion, between two friends on a walk, of the modern evidences for Intelligent Design (ID) in Nature, vs. Darwin’s increasingly implausible theory of creation by pure chance or Unintelligent Design (UD). Powerful modern evidences, also, for the super natural from Near Death and out of Body Experiences and much more. There is a tremendous depth and scope to this book which manages to cover so many vital topics-not usually considered together, scientific, philosophical and spiritual-in a relatively short amount of space. If you love to know what may really be true, this readable, engaging book is for you.
